#682862 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#682862 is composed of 40.8% red, 15.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 5.8%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 305.6 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 28.2%. #682862 color hex could be obtained by blending #d050c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#682862 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#682862 has RGB values of R:104, G:40,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.06,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6826082.

Shades and Tints of #682862
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fb is the lightest one.
